P M A ! ! !   Positive  Mental  Attitude!  (Oh, and follow the 6-P's. Had to get that in here, too!)
 
     Once you've gone through the Program and made your plan, maintaining a Positive Mental Attitude minute to minute, hour to hour will make the quitting process sooo much easier!  The nico-demon feeds off your negativity... lurking, waiting for that moment of weakness when you start to think to yourself that you can't take it one more minute!!!  If you keep that PMA going you can self talk yourself right through that crave and give that demon one more kick in the ash!  
 
    PMA is all about gaining your freedom!!!  I CAN do this!!!  I AM a non-smoker!!!  I CAN win one more battle against ol' nic!!!  PMA WILL make you the winner!  It will also make you a more pleasant person to be around!!!    
 
     I do hope you will take the time to share with all of our fellow quit buddies!
 
            Have a great smoke-free weekend!!!
